Michael Odeh is an American poker player from Las Vegas, Nevada, with over $176k in live tournament earnings. His best live cash of $38,311 came when he won at the World Poker Challenge in March 2006.

Michael Odeh: Live Tournament Participation

Michael Odeh’s first recorded live cash occurred in July 2005 at the Orleans Open in Las Vegas. He finished in 2nd place in a $100 + 25 No Limit Hold’em, cashing $4,910.

Following this, in October 2005, Michael entered in a $1,000 + 60 No Limit Hold’em Championship at the Fall Poker Classic in Shakopee. He ended up in 7th place, taking home $12,324.

Then, in November 2005, Michael joined in a $300 + 30 No Limit Hold’em at the WSOP Circuit in Las Vegas. He made 1st place finish, winning $12,885.

In February 2006, he took part in a $300 + 40 No Limit Hold’em at the WSOPC in San Diego. He finished in 1st place, adding $12,885 to his winnings.

Later that year, in March, Michael played in a $500 + 50 No Limit Hold’em at the World Poker Challenge in Reno. He ended up in 1st place, winning his best live cash of $38,311 to date.

Moreover, in July 2006, he participated in a $2,000 No Limit Hold’em at the 37th WSOP in Las Vegas. He finished in 14th place, pocketing $37,359.

In June 2024, Michael competed in a $1,500 No Limit Hold’em Monster Stack Bracelet Event #38 at the 55th WSOP. He ended up in 583rd place, earning $3,998.
